Last week, in class 5C we were learning about 3D shapes. We looked at 2D representations of 3D shapes and attempted to make the correct shape out of unifix cubes. Later on in the week, we drew our own 2D representations of a 3D shape and swapped with a partner so that they could attempt to make our shape. It was challenging yet fun. Some people struggled when attempting to make their partner’s shape. Overall, it was cube-rific!
